gpt4 book ai didi

html - 当父级使用自动高度时,如何在父级 div 内重叠 div?

转载 作者:太空宇宙 更新时间:2023-11-03 19:51:08 25 4
gpt4 key购买 nike

我有两个 div,我想将它们放在另一个之上,这样我就可以在我制作的 applet 中创建一个选项卡系统。这两个 div 驻留在一个父 div 中,它使用自动高度,因为我不知道其他两个 div 的确切高度(两个 child 的高度相同)。当父级使用相对定位时,我可以使用绝对定位将两个 div 一个放在另一个之上,但是自动高度没有响应(很可能是因为绝对定位的子级)创建一个空 div 的边界线而不是一个内部包含元素的包装器。

请在此处查看问题:http://jsfiddle.net/h5bjt69s/

<div id = "parent">
<div id = "redDiv"></div>
<div class = "clearfix"></div>
<div id = "blueDiv"></div>
</div>

我尝试从中建模一个解决方案,但我相信自动高度会把事情搞砸。 Position absolute but relative to parent

如何将两个 div 包裹在父 div 中并仍然保持两个子 div 的叠加?

最佳答案

这个:

both children will be of same height

实际解决了你的问题:

  • 使用 position: static 定位一个 div;它将确定 parent 的高度
  • 使用 position: absolute 定位其他 div(它将出现在顶部)

Updated Fiddle

关于html - 当父级使用自动高度时,如何在父级 div 内重叠 div?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/25450371/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com